When the Bears be picking on Day 3 of the 2025 NFL draft

The 2025 NFL draft is drawing to a close, and the Chicago Bears are gearing up to put a bow on what's been an impactful draft so far.

After selecting Michigan tight end Colston Loveland in the first round, the Bears continued to add to their offense while also addressing the offensive and defensive trenches. Chicago landed a first-round prospect in Missouri wide receiver Luther Burden III at 39th overall while shoring up the trenches with the selections of offensive tackle Ozzy Trapilo (56th overall) and defensive tackle Shemar Turner (62nd overall).

But there's still work to be done on the final day of the draft for the Bears.
